﻿<?xml version="1.0" encoding="utf-8"?><Type Name="SqlBulkCopyOptions" FullName="System.Data.SqlClient.SqlBulkCopyOptions"><TypeSignature Language="C#" Value="public enum SqlBulkCopyOptions" /><AssemblyInfo><AssemblyName>System.Data</AssemblyName><AssemblyVersion>2.0.0.0</AssemblyVersion></AssemblyInfo><Base><BaseTypeName>System.Enum</BaseTypeName></Base><Attributes><Attribute><AttributeName>System.Flags</AttributeName></Attribute></Attributes><Docs><since version=".NET 2.0" /><remarks><attribution license="cc4" from="Microsoft" modified="false" /><para>You can use the <see cref="T:System.Data.SqlClient.SqlBulkCopyOptions" /> enumeration when you construct a <see cref="T:System.Data.SqlClient.SqlBulkCopy" /> instance to change how the <see cref="Overload:System.Data.SqlClient.SqlBulkCopy.WriteToServer" /> methods for that instance behave.</para></remarks><summary><attribution license="cc4" from="Microsoft" modified="false" /><para>Bitwise flag that specifies one or more options to use with an instance of <see cref="T:System.Data.SqlClient.SqlBulkCopy" />.</para></summary></Docs><Members><Member MemberName="CheckConstraints"><MemberSignature Language="C#" Value="CheckConstraints" /><MemberType>Field</MemberType><ReturnValue><ReturnType>System.Data.SqlClient.SqlBulkCopyOptions</ReturnType></ReturnValue><Docs><since version=".NET 2.0" /><summary><attribution license="cc4" from="Microsoft" modified="false" /><para>Check constraints while data is being inserted. By default, constraints are not checked.</para></summary></Docs><AssemblyInfo><AssemblyVersion>2.0.0.0</AssemblyVersion></AssemblyInfo></Member><Member MemberName="Default"><MemberSignature Language="C#" Value="Default" /><MemberType>Field</MemberType><ReturnValue><ReturnType>System.Data.SqlClient.SqlBulkCopyOptions</ReturnType></ReturnValue><Docs><since version=".NET 2.0" /><summary><attribution license="cc4" from="Microsoft" modified="false" /><para>Use the default values for all options.</para></summary></Docs><AssemblyInfo><AssemblyVersion>2.0.0.0</AssemblyVersion></AssemblyInfo></Member><Member MemberName="FireTriggers"><MemberSignature Language="C#" Value="FireTriggers" /><MemberType>Field</MemberType><ReturnValue><ReturnType>System.Data.SqlClient.SqlBulkCopyOptions</ReturnType></ReturnValue><Docs><since version=".NET 2.0" /><summary><attribution license="cc4" from="Microsoft" modified="false" /><para>When specified, cause the server to fire the insert triggers for the rows being inserted into the database.</para></summary></Docs><AssemblyInfo><AssemblyVersion>2.0.0.0</AssemblyVersion></AssemblyInfo></Member><Member MemberName="KeepIdentity"><MemberSignature Language="C#" Value="KeepIdentity" /><MemberType>Field</MemberType><ReturnValue><ReturnType>System.Data.SqlClient.SqlBulkCopyOptions</ReturnType></ReturnValue><Docs><since version=".NET 2.0" /><summary><attribution license="cc4" from="Microsoft" modified="false" /><para>Preserve source identity values. When not specified, identity values are assigned by the destination.</para></summary></Docs><AssemblyInfo><AssemblyVersion>2.0.0.0</AssemblyVersion></AssemblyInfo></Member><Member MemberName="KeepNulls"><MemberSignature Language="C#" Value="KeepNulls" /><MemberType>Field</MemberType><ReturnValue><ReturnType>System.Data.SqlClient.SqlBulkCopyOptions</ReturnType></ReturnValue><Docs><since version=".NET 2.0" /><summary><attribution license="cc4" from="Microsoft" modified="false" /><para>Preserve null values in the destination table regardless of the settings for default values. When not specified, null values are replaced by default values where applicable.</para></summary></Docs><AssemblyInfo><AssemblyVersion>2.0.0.0</AssemblyVersion></AssemblyInfo></Member><Member MemberName="TableLock"><MemberSignature Language="C#" Value="TableLock" /><MemberType>Field</MemberType><ReturnValue><ReturnType>System.Data.SqlClient.SqlBulkCopyOptions</ReturnType></ReturnValue><Docs><since version=".NET 2.0" /><summary><attribution license="cc4" from="Microsoft" modified="false" /><para>Obtain a bulk update lock for the duration of the bulk copy operation. When not specified, row locks are used.</para></summary></Docs><AssemblyInfo><AssemblyVersion>2.0.0.0</AssemblyVersion></AssemblyInfo></Member><Member MemberName="UseInternalTransaction"><MemberSignature Language="C#" Value="UseInternalTransaction" /><MemberType>Field</MemberType><ReturnValue><ReturnType>System.Data.SqlClient.SqlBulkCopyOptions</ReturnType></ReturnValue><Docs><since version=".NET 2.0" /><summary><attribution license="cc4" from="Microsoft" modified="false" /><para>When specified, each batch of the bulk-copy operation will occur within a transaction. If you indicate this option and also provide a <see cref="T:System.Data.SqlClient.SqlTransaction" /> object to the constructor, an <see cref="T:System.ArgumentException" /> occurs.</para></summary></Docs><AssemblyInfo><AssemblyVersion>2.0.0.0</AssemblyVersion></AssemblyInfo></Member></Members></Type>